xquery-3.0-oauth's Introduction

Hello,

This repository contains an OAuth implementation written in XQuery 3.0. 
It is actually derived from https://github.com/grtjn/XQuery-OAuth which 
relies on several MarkLogic extensions at the moment.

Also, there's no native implementation of the HMAC-SHA1 signing algorithm
at the moment, so this script relies on a web service to compute that.

If you want to setup the web service yourself, contact 
Norman Walsh (https://github.com/ndw) who started this  project.
